R3 Continuum eagerly embraces diversity and is a committed Equal Opportunity Employer to all qualified applicants, ensuring individuals will not be discriminated against based on any protected classifications.Join a company dedicated to helping people and organizations be more resilient and thrive.Position SummaryThe Remote Client Care Clinician adheres to departmental goals, objectives, standards of performance, and policies and procedures, ensuring compliance with quality care. Clinicians engage with individuals who have been impacted by a crisis and offer immediate behavioral health support and coaching. Clinical Intake/ConsultationConduct clinical intakes via telephone to assess behavioral health needs and determine appropriate level of careAssist with care triaging and provider matching Provide direct behavioral health support via telephone to individuals who are requesting clinical servicesManage emergent clinical situations as needed, including safety planning and/or crisis intervention support via telephone to individualsInteract with individuals to assist them in gaining insight, defining goals, and planning action to achieve effective personal or vocational development and adjustmentProviding advice on best practices and implementation for individual behavioral health, and workplace resilience and wellbeingConsult with or provide consultation to other doctors, therapists, or clinicians regarding careConsult with or provide consultation to internal and external management teamsCommunicate with people outside the organization, representing the organization to customers and other external sourcesMaintain collaborative relationships with coworkers, customers, and clientsInterpret the meaning of clinical information for non-cliniciansConsistently meet department clinical billable standards for clinical intake/consultation workCrisis Response Essential FunctionsProvide direct behavioral health support to individuals, groups and organizations who have experienced a disruptive eventMeet department standards related to crisis response volumes, realizing the unpredictable nature of these types of requestsProvide guidance and expert advice to management or other groups on technical, systems-, or process-related topicsUtilize various methods of behavioral health service delivery including telephone, video, and on-site Communicate with people outside the organization, representing the organization to customers and other external sources.Provide consultation to individuals and groups regarding problems, such as stress and trauma, to modify behavior or to improve personal, social, or vocational adjustment.Provide advice on best practices and implementation for individual behavioral health, and workplace resilience and wellbeingProvide consultation to other clinicians regarding best practices in psychological first aid and disruptive event managementMaintain collaborative relationships with coworkers, customers, and clientsComplete reports within designated time framesOther Essential Functions Develop specific goals and plans to prioritize, organize, and accomplish your workDevelop, design, or create new applications, ideas, relationships, systems, or productsEncourage and build mutual trust, respect, and cooperation among team membersConsult reference material, such as textbooks, manuals, or journals to enhance learningConduct presentations and trainings for customers and clients on behavioral health topics and servicesParticipate in department and company meetings, as requestedOther duties as assignedOvertime/additional hours may be mandatory at times due to changes in workloadFlexible Schedule – Schedule will change based on company need.
